Six Sunnahs you can do in the rain

Image
Ever wondered what are the Sunnah actions to do when it rains? Here’s a quick list to get you started of what to do during all the different stages of rainfall. Ask Allah to make it beneficial The first thing to do when it starts raining is to say “اللّهُمَّ صَيِّـباً نَافِعاً”, which means “May Allah grant us beneficial rain”. -Sunan An-Nisai Perhaps your sincere supplication will ward off any potential harm of the coming rain and instead bring about a great benefit. Stand under the rain Try to catch a few raindrops onto your clothing in hopes of receiving some of the blessings of the rain. Anas Bin Malik reported “Whilst we were with the Messenger of Allah ﷺ rain fell upon us. The Messenger then exposed part of his garment so that rain fell on his body.
